Choosing the Ideal Aluminum Zed Profile for Your Project
Successfully finishing your structure copyrights on selecting the appropriate aluminum Zed profile. These versatile pieces, also referred to Zed supports, offer exceptional strength and lightweight properties, making them perfect for various construction needs. Consider the required load-bearing capacity; a thicker section will handle greater loads. Moreover, the specified length and configuration play a vital role. Lastly, be sure to check the aluminum's grade – typically 6061 or 6063 – to ensure maximum durability.
